I'll start with the good stuff and the question that's probably most important, what kind of stuff can you get with what you earn? The answer is pretty much just about anything. For only a few points (swagbucks) you can enter sweepstakes or even donate to charities. While they have gift cards for nearly everything on there, I choose to use my swagbucks for Amazon credit because it's the most bang for your buck.
*My Gift Cards section on Swagbucks (I did it in two transactions as I wanted to see if they were instant rewards. After submitting the first $5 one I then saw that it stated 8-10 business days for you to receive your rewards so I submitted the rest immediately to ensure I got it in time for holiday shopping)
For 450 swagbucks you can get a $5 Amazon credit code sent to your email. A $5 code to other popular retailers costs 500 swagbucks, which is still a good deal if you don't use Amazon. There's even a paypal cashout option, but that doesn't start until 2500 swagbucks for $25. So basically, Amazon credit aside, it's a penny a swagbuck, with a $5 cashout threshold. A great rate in the world of paid tasks and survey sites, plus the low cashout threshold is a bonus.
How do you earn swagbucks? There's lots of different tasks you can do on the site to earn credit. There's a daily poll you can answer for 1 swagbuck, a No Obligation Special Offers (NOSO) path that you click through daily for 2 swagbucks, swagbucks earned for completing surveys, watching videos....many ways to earn. You can also use the site as a gateway to the printable coupon site coupons.com and earn 10 swagbucks for every coupon redeemed, and if you online shop frequently, you can shop through swagbucks and earn swagbucks per dollar spent. You can also earn by using their search bar for your everyday web browsing. Instead of opening your browser and directly typing the webpage in, go to swagbucks and search for where you need to go. You are randomly awarded swagbucks for searches. The site says the amounts are random from 1-1000 but from my experience it generally averages from 6-13 swagbucks. There are lots of ways to earn, but I stick mainly to the search bar, surveys and the daily tasks. It would take a long time to really describe them all, so go check them out for yourself! Also, there's special contests that the site has throughout the year where you can win a few extra SBs.
Swagcode: At least once daily (sometimes multiple times in one day) Swagbucks will release a code that you can enter on the site for bonus swagbucks. These are a varied amount (I just entered one for 14pts today). For the best chance of catching these, like Swagbucks on facebook, as well as like SwagCodez as it's a facebook page dedicated to updating on the latest code. Once released, the code is only good for usually 2 hours or so, so you have to be quick to catch it. It's a great and easy way to add a few points to your daily tally.
I'm sure the next pressing questions you have are: how easy is it to earn credit and how much time do you have to spend to really earn anything? When telling people about swagbucks, I usually tell them this: If you did ONLY the two most basic tasks, the daily poll and click through the NOSO path (it can range from 1 to 5 different offers you have to click through (just choose skip to go to the next one) and quite often there's only one offer to skip) you will spend maybe a half of a minute on the site and earn 3 swagbucks. If you do only this every day, by December 1st (345 days from the time I'm writing this) you will have earned 345x3=1035 Swagbucks + 50 SB bonus on your birthday = 1085 Swagbucks which is good enough for $10 worth of gift cards for holiday shopping. It doesn't sound like much, but that's also for less than a minute of time a day. Now if you take your time commitment and up it by only 1 to 2 minutes to do some searching in their search bar (sometimes you get SBs on your first search, sometimes you have to do many searches to be awarded) and even if you only earned 6 extra swagbucks a day, you are now up to 3155 swagbucks by next holiday shopping season which will get you $30 in gift cards (or $35 in amazon credit). That's just a low ball number too as frequently I get 8 or more SBs on a search.
Currently, swagbucks has a daily goal program where you are given two goal thresholds to hit for the day. It looks like this:
If you reach the goal, you are awarded the qualifying bonus. Above is my first daily goal for today. If I earn 30 SBs today, I will get 3 bonus SBs. Once I hit 30, it switches to my second goal for the day which for today is 90. If I hit that, I will get an additional 9 SBs. You don't get the bonus SBs right away, rather they are awarded monthly, which can make for a nice surprise. Sometimes they start you off at a low goal of 20, sometimes the first goal is ridiculously high like 100 or more. Whenever it starts off at 20 or 30 I try to hit that goal if I have time to. It really doesn't take a whole lot. I just do my few minutes of searches a couple of times throughout the day, do my daily tasks, click through the watch and earn clips, etc. I do surveys whenever I can as well, but you aren't credited right away for them, so surveys will not generally count towards your goal for that day, except for the fact that you do earn 1 SB for every time you do not qualify for a survey (you are limited by the number of times you can get this 1 credit per disqualification credit...I think it's 5 per day).
